Understanding the Mechanics and Terminology

Before diving into strategies and the nuances of playing crash games, it’s important to understand the common terminology and core mechanics. The ‘multiplier’ indicates how much your initial bet will be multiplied by when you cash out. For example, a multiplier of 2x means you’ll receive twice your initial stake back, while a multiplier of 10x means you’ll receive ten times your stake. The challenge is that this multiplier is constantly increasing, but the game can end – ‘crash’ – at any moment, returning nothing if you haven't cashed out. Many platforms also offer features like ‘auto-cash out,’ allowing you to set a specific multiplier at which your bet will automatically be withdrawn, removing the need for manual timing. Understanding the random number generator (RNG) that determines when the crash occurs is key, although it's important to remember that it’s fundamentally unpredictable.

The Role of Provably Fair Technology

A crucial aspect of reputable crash games is the implementation of provably fair technology. This system allows players to verify the fairness of each game round, ensuring that the outcome hasn’t been manipulated by the operator. Provably fair systems typically use cryptographic algorithms to generate random seeds that determine the crash point. Players can then independently verify these seeds to confirm the legitimacy of the results. This transparency builds trust and provides players with confidence that the game is genuinely random and unbiased. Without provably fair systems, the integrity of the game would be highly suspect, and players would have no way of knowing if they were being subjected to unfair practices.

The Importance of Bankroll Management

Effective bankroll management is paramount when playing crash games. It’s essential to set a budget and stick to it, avoiding the temptation to chase losses. A general rule of thumb is to only bet a small percentage of your bankroll on each round – typically between 1% and 5%. This limits your potential losses and allows you to withstand losing streaks. Furthermore, it’s crucial to have a predetermined stop-loss limit, at which point you’ll cease playing, regardless of your current win or loss. Disciplined bankroll management is the cornerstone of responsible gambling and can help you enjoy the game without risking financial hardship.

Psychological Factors in Crash Gameplay

The psychological aspect of crash games is often underestimated. The excitement of watching the multiplier climb can lead to impulsive decisions and a tendency to hold on for too long, hoping to achieve a higher payout. This ‘greed’ can be a major downfall, as the crash can occur at any moment. Players also often fall victim to the ‘gambler’s fallacy,’ believing that a crash is ‘due’ after a long period without one. However, each round is independent, and the probability of a crash remains constant. Maintaining emotional control and sticking to your pre-determined strategy, regardless of the current multiplier or past results, is critical for success. The ability to detach yourself emotionally from the game and view it objectively can significantly improve your decision-making process.

Recognizing and Avoiding Tilt

‘Tilt’ is a term used to describe a state of emotional frustration or anger that can impair your judgment and lead to reckless betting. When on tilt, players often deviate from their established strategies and make impulsive decisions, increasing their risk of losing. Recognizing the signs of tilt – such as increased bet sizes, chasing losses, or feeling overly emotional – is the first step to avoiding it. If you find yourself tilting, it’s best to take a break from the game and clear your head. Stepping away allows you to regain emotional control and return to the game with a more rational mindset.
